Nice tokays! I think normal ones are already among the nicest geckos, as far as color goes. Unfortunately they are agressive little monsters and their reputation will make it difficult for them to become really popular as pets. But then who knows, there is also demand for aggressive pitbulls Wink
I think breeding a really tame line could do a lot for getting them popular Laughing Anyone want a new project?

Nice pics.My cousin keeps the leucistic[white] ones.Sadly they are just as grumpy and bitey as the normal type.
Beautiful looking geckos but not a type i'd keep as i'd be too nervous cleaning them out.This is probably due to being bitten badly by one of my cousins adults.
